Finding the Aisan Cougar in Thief Simulator: A Player's Guide
In the thrilling world of Thief Simulator, players unlock several exciting features as they progress in the game - one of them being the luxury of stealing cars. High-end cars, when stolen, can yield a considerable amount of money. One such vehicle is the Aisan Cougar, which sells for $800. Successfully stealing this car also unlocks the 'Car Enthusiast 2' trophy/achievement. However, finding the Aisan Cougar can be a bit tricky, and this guide aims to assist you on this high-risk mission.

Vulpix Spotlight Hour: A Shimmering Chance Arrives in Pokemon GO
The six-tailed fox Pokemon, Vulpix, takes center stage in Pokemon GO Spotlight Hour. This burst of fiery excitement allows trainers the chance to encounter and capture an abundance of Vulpix within the limited 60-minute timeframe. Sporting a stat spread of 96 (ATK), 109 (DEF), and 116 (STA), Vulpix is a pure Fire-type Pokemon whose best attack combination consists of Quick Attack and Weather Ball.
